Output 32da180405b580e7cc2f4dc11a1430ec66d3430a3e9fffe138e50894e44dc0da:0

value
1436157
script pubkey
OP_0 OP_PUSHBYTES_20 8af4ddb618c855952747d330c7ea51aa0aaeea03
address
bc1q3t6dmdscep2e2f686vcv06j34g92a6sr6g269z
transaction
32da180405b580e7cc2f4dc11a1430ec66d3430a3e9fffe138e50894e44dc0da